About Semantic Scholar

Semantic Scholar is a free academic search engine and research graph for finding papers, authors, citations, related work, and scholarly context. It belongs in Research & Search.

Key Features

  • 200M+ academic papers indexed
  • AI-generated paper summaries (TLDR)
  • Citation influence analysis
  • Research feed recommendations
  • Free open API for developers
